NGail Nov 25th, 2016 01:49 PM

We're back!
Ate at Gordon Biersch Restaurant and Brewery and it worked out very well.
It's located on F Street and 9th, walking distance from the hotel some of us were at, and a not-bad drive from Falls Church.
Kind of a sporty, casual place. Our room was glassed off from the rest of restaurant so it was quiet and there was plenty of space so the kids could float around, which was great.
Cost about $750 up front, for the room and the food and drink, and since we spent less than that, we were given the difference as a gift card - very fair, I thought.
Food was good and service efficient. We lingered for over 2 1/2 hours and never felt rushed.
So, highly recommended, if you have a mixed crowd like ours.
